You didn't say what your were trying to cost, inventory or serving cost. A $2 calculator & excel spread sheet would be your best without more info of what you need to do. For serving/portion costing, many free recipe programs can do this if you enter ingredient cost correctly. Many inventory cost control programs also require a link to the order system & cash register to produce and 'end of day' usage report and restock report. These are not cheap and require a computer/cash register system. ... On a Truck, you should be able to do this without an expensive computer system. Just look at the your racks to see what was used up. So for a truck, an excel sheet would be the best for an inventory & check list to track current pricing and to produce an order sheet for supplies. This can easily track daily, weekly, and monthly usage & cost of food stuff & supplies.
